Search Results
                    
                    
            https://dev.mysql.com/doc/mysql-em-plugin/en/myoem-performance-page-database-file-io.html
                                Table 5.2 Database File I/O By Host NameDescription Host The host from which the client connected. Rows for which the HOST column in the underlying Performance Schema table is NULL are assumed to be for background threads and are reported with a ...
                                            
                https://dev.mysql.com/doc/internals/en/tracing-example.html
                                } ] /* items */, "resulting_clause_is_simple": true, "resulting_clause": "`test`.`alias1`.`col_int_key`" So we get a shorter ORDER BY clause - and this is not visible in EXPLAIN or EXPLAIN EXTENDED!! This simplification can be worth it: this shorter ...The statement's execution is naturally made of "steps": "steps": [ { "join_preparation": { This is a join's preparation "select#": 1, for the first SELECT of the statement (which has only one, ...
                                            
                https://dev.mysql.com/doc/internals/en/x-protocol-messages-messages.html
                                Returns Mysqlx.Resultset:: message Update { required Collection collection = 2; optional DataModel data_model = 3; optional Mysqlx.Expr.Expr criteria = 4; repeated Mysqlx.Datatypes.Scalar args = 8; optional Limit limit = 5; repeated Order order = 6; ... Topics in this section: Message Structure Message Sequence Common Messages Connection Session Expectations CRUD SQL Result Sets Expressions Data Types This section provides detailed information about how X Protocol defines ...
                                            
                https://dev.mysql.com/doc/workbench/en/wb-preferences-sql-editor.html
                                 This section provides configuration options that affect the SQL editor functionality in MySQL Workbench. Permits saving and reloading the SQL editor tabs after MySQL Workbench is closed and reopened (including after an unexpected shutdown). 
                                            
                https://dev.mysql.com/doc/workbench/en/wb-data-modeling-menus.html
                                 Some menu items are not available in the MySQL Workbench Community Edition of this application, and are available only in the MySQL Workbench Commercial Editions. 9.1.1.1.1 The File Menu Use the File menu to open a project, begin a new project, or ...
                                            
                https://dev.mysql.com/doc/x-devapi-userguide/en/method-chaining.html
                                 X DevAPI supports a number of modern practices to make working with CRUD operations easier and to fit naturally into modern development environments. This section explains how to use method chaining instead of working with SQL strings of JSON ...
                                            
                https://dev.mysql.com/doc/internals/en/optimizer-group-by-related-conditions.html
                                For the case GROUP BY x ORDER BY x, the optimizer will realize that the ORDER BY is unnecessary, because the GROUP BY comes out in order by x. Because DISTINCT is not always transformed to GROUP BY, do not expect that queries with DISTINCT will ...
                                            
                https://dev.mysql.com/doc/internals/en/optimizer-partition-pruning.html
                                Each index is described by an ordered list of the columns which it covers: (keypart1, keypart2, ..., keypartN) For partition pruning, Range Analyzer is invoked with the WHERE clause and a list of table columns used by the partitioning and ...
                                            
                https://dev.mysql.com/doc/internals/en/connection-phase-packets.html
                                 Protocol::Handshake Initial Handshake Packet When the client connects to the server the server sends a handshake packet to the client. Depending on the server version and configuration options different variants of the initial packet are sent. To ...
                                            
                https://dev.mysql.com/doc/mysql-errors/8.4/en/server-error-reference.html
                                A deadlock occurs when requests for locks arrive in inconsistent order between transactions. SELECT is unsafe because the order in which rows are retrieved by the SELECT determines which (if any) rows are ignored. This order cannot be predicted and ... The MySQL server writes some error messages to its error log, and sends others to client ...